The opportunity

The role will play a crucial part in performing and coordinating service activities in relation to our portfolio predominantly in Perth Western Australia and will focus on Service and technical support for State of the Art Surgical Robotics Systems but will also include work on a variety of Medical Equipment including critical care and ophthalmology.

Key Responsibilities:

Field Service

  • Perform corrective service preventative maintenance and in-house repair in a professional and customer-oriented manner;
  • Promptly respond to all service and support calls designated by Technical Service coordinators and regional / national service management;
  • Participate in the service management system by actively communicating calendar scheduling with Technical Service coordinators promptly entering Technical Service Report (TSR) data and effectively managing spare parts inventory;
  • Participate in equipment installations as required working with a team of internal and external technicians engineers and contractors or the onsite team/hospital facilities department to install and commission equipment;
  • Work closely with other departments to contribute to the sales and business development process and ensure that customer needs are met;
  • Maintain a safe working environment and proactively identify and deal with issues;
  • Escalate identified product faults to regional management and follow up with customer on fault resolution as appropriate;
  • Effectively track and account for boot stock spare parts inventory via regular stock takes;
  • Participate in spare parts warranty returns processes in a timely manner;
  • Utilise loan stock equipment to service customer requirements track and account for equipment movements and maintain equipment in a fully serviceable state;
  • Maintain the companys responsibilities relating to Electrical Licensing including completing any required electrical qualification to carry out the requirements of the position (where applicable).

Technical Support

  • Provide both intraoperative and non-intraoperative technical phone support to customers and field personnel including Sales Service Marketing etc.
  • Quickly become knowledgeable on policies processes and procedures as well as knowledge of best practices.
  • Analyse and troubleshoot complex robotic problems using remote diagnostics over the telephone.
  • Review RemoteFE auto-generated Service Requests and dispatch Field Service Orders as required through SAP/CRM.
  • Drive resolution of da Vinci technical issues until acceptable solution is identified and implemented or it is determined escalation is necessary.
  • Available to provide onsite support for any escalated technical issues or Customer Care sites per management needs.
  • Drive key metrics to support corporate/departmental goals.
  • Facilitate technical requests from field engineers.
  • Responsible for creating dispatching and tracking service requests in the SAP/CRM business system.
  • Have a flexible work schedule including holidays and on-call duties.
